Abduction
The movement of a limb or part away from the midline of the body, or the act of forcibly taking someone away against their will.
Bed Rest
A medical recommendation or treatment which involves prolonged periods of lying down, often used to promote healing or prevent worsening of a condition.
Baseline Blood Pressure
The initial blood pressure measurement used as a reference point to monitor changes over time or assess the effects of interventions.
Respiratory Function
The performance and health of the respiratory system, including the process of breathing and the exchange of oxygen and carbon dioxide in the body.
